Lindsay Precast, Inc. Assistant Controller in Alachua, Florida

Job Title: Assistant Controller

Job Overview:

We are seeking a highly motivated and detail-oriented Assistant Controller to join our dynamic finance team. The ideal candidate will play a crucial role in managing the general ledger, driving process improvements, implementing efficient financial processes, overseeing cost allocations, and leveraging technology to enhance financial reporting. This position requires a candidate with str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and a proactive approach to problem-solving. The successful candidate will have experience with Power BI and a proven track record in implementing and optimizing financial systems and processes.

Key Responsibilities:

  • General Ledger Management:

  • Ensure accurate and timely recording of financial transactions.

  • Reconcile and analyze general ledger accounts to maintain the integrity of financial data.

  • Prepare and review financial statements for accuracy and compliance with accounting standards.

  • Process Improvement and Implementation:

  • Identify opportunities for process improvements and efficiency gains within the finance department.

  • Work closely with cross-functional teams to implement process changes and streamline financial workflows.

  • Develop and document standard operating procedures to ensure consistency and compliance.

  • Cost Allocations:

  • Oversee the cost allocation process to ensure accurate and equitable distribution of expenses.

  • Analyze cost allocation methods and recommend improvements for better cost management.

  • Technology Integration:

  • Leverage technology, including Power BI, to enhance financial reporting and analysis capabilities.

  • Stay updated on emerging technologies and recommend tools that can improve financial processes.

  • Collaborate with IT to implement and integrate financial systems and software.

  • Financial Reporting:

  • Prepare regular financial reports and dashboards using Power BI for management review.

  • Analyze financial data to provide insights into business performance and trends.

  • Ensure compliance with regulatory reporting requirements.

Qualifications

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field. CPA or CMA certification is a plus.

  • Proven experience in general ledger management, financial reporting, and cost allocations.

  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with a keen attention to detail.

  • Demonstrated ability to lead process improvement initiatives and implement efficient financial processes.

  • Tech-savvy with expertise in using Power BI for financial reporting and analysis.

  • Knowledge of accounting software and ERP systems; experience in system implementation is a plus.

  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to collaborate effectively across departments.
